Annual General Meeting and Conference
This event will take place on 18th to 20th August 2007 in Sandton
Convention Centre, Johannesburg, South Africa and will see over
500 business leaders, government representatives and members
of ASCCI getting together to discuss issues of Trade and Investments
in the region.
Amongst other issues to be discussed at the AGM, the role of
government and private sector in creating an enabling environment
for economic growth and private sector development in the region.
The other issues include NEPAD and African business opportunities,
PPPs, SMME Development, 2010 opportunities for the region as
well as the release of the results for the Regional Business Climate
Survey for 2007, together with other current topical issues affecting
business in the Region, Africa and Globally.

ASCCI SMME Development Conference
This annual event has become one of ASCCI’s highlights since its
inception a year ago. The conference focuses on challenges faced
by SMMEs in doing business within their countries such as:
-
Access to Finance
- Access to Markets
- Access to infrastructure support
- Access to Information
- Access to Training and Development Services
- Friendly regulatory environment; and
- Other related constraints preventing SMME's from doing business in a cost effective way.

Economics for Prosperity Conference
The 1st biennial Economics for Prosperity Conference took place
in SA between 30/11/05 – 01/12/05, covered such topics as:
- Millennium Development and the Market.
- A global perspective.
- Inter Regional Trade under legislative harmonisation:
Myth or Reality?
- Doing business in Africa
- Property and income equality
- Challenges and changes in Transforming Public Sector
Enterprises.
- Barriers to free trade and investment.
And other topical issues.
The Corporate Council for Africa Summit in partnership with
ASCCI
The Corporate Council for Africa, in partnership with ASCCI, plans
to host its summit in South Africa in November 2007. The summit
is intended to bring about 500 United States Companies intending
to do business in the SADC region as well as in Africa.
ASCCI in partnership with its member chambers will mobilize
companies in the SADC region to participate in this high level
networking event designed to facilitate Business to Business,
matchmaking, partnerships, joint ventures, foreign direct investment,
as well as BEE opportunities.
